A quality after construction cleaning is not the same as standard janitorial work. Post-construction cleaning requires detailed dust removal, surface wipe-downs, and careful attention to finishing areas like trim, fixtures, glass, and floors. Post construction cleaning services we provide
Our post construction cleaning Amarillo TX service can be tailored based on the space and the stage of your project. Common tasks include:
Dust removal after renovation (walls, ledges, vents, surfaces, corners)
Detail wipe-downs (counters, cabinets exteriors, doors, trim, baseboards)
Glass and mirror cleaning (smudges, residue, fingerprints)
Floor cleaning (vacuuming, sweeping, mopping as appropriate)
Bathroom cleaning (fixtures, mirrors, counters, floors)
Kitchen cleaning (surfaces, exterior cabinets, counters, floors)
Trash/debris gathering (light debris and packaging cleanup as applicable)
Final touch cleaning (presentation-ready finish)

1) What is post construction cleaning?
Post construction cleaning in Amarillo, TX is a detailed cleanup after remodeling, build-outs, or new construction. It focuses on removing construction dust, residue, and smudges so the space feels truly move-in ready—not just “almost finished.”
2) Is post-construction cleaning different from regular janitorial cleaning?
Yes. Post-construction cleaning is more detailed and focuses on dust removal and presentation. It’s designed for spaces that have recently had work completed and need a thorough final clean before occupancy or inspections.
3) What’s included in your post construction cleanup service?
Typical post-construction cleaning includes dust removal, wipe-downs of surfaces, cleaning glass and mirrors, cleaning floors, and detail cleaning of kitchens and bathrooms when applicable. The exact checklist depends on the type of project (residential or commercial) and the condition of the space.
4) Do you offer post construction cleaning for both residential and commercial projects?
Yes. We provide residential post construction cleaning after home remodels and commercial post construction cleaning for build-outs, tenant improvements, offices, retail spaces, and other facilities.
5) When should post-construction cleaning be scheduled?
Post-construction cleaning is best scheduled once major work is complete and the space is ready for final presentation. We can coordinate timing so the cleaning happens as close to move-in or opening as possible.
6) How long does post construction cleaning take?
Timelines depend on the size of the space, how much dust/debris is present, and what tasks are included. After reviewing the project details (or a walkthrough), we’ll provide a realistic timeline for your specific space.
